MANCHESTER: Phil Foden says Manchester City remain fresh and ready to fight for the quadruple after he scored late to give them the edge against Borussia Dortmund in theirFoden struck in the 90th minute to give the Premier League leaders a hard-earned 2-1 win in the first leg at the Etihad Stadium on Tuesday , minutes after Marco Reus looked to have snatched a draw for the German side.
"The manager is rotating and so we are ready and I think as a team we are doing brilliantly. We are fighting for everything we can and are going to fight until the end." City have now won 27 of their past 28 games in all competitions, and remain on course for a historic sweep of the Champions League, Premier League, FA Cup and League Cup.
But they have failed to get beyond the last eight in the Champions League in each of Pep Guardiola's four previous seasons in charge, and had to dig deep for their win against Dortmund.
